Switch to English?
Yes
Переключитись на українську?
Так
Переключиться на русскую?
Да
Przełączyć się na polską?
Tak

Lexara — a modern SaaS platform for task management

Lexara – a full-featured SaaS platform developed using a modern technology stack. The project demonstrates the creation of a scalable web application with an authentication system, subscription management, billing, and multilingual support.

Frontend
Next.js 15 - React framework with App Router
TypeScript - static typing
Tailwind CSS - modern CSS library
Radix UI – accessible UI components
React Hook Form - form management
Zod - schema validation

Backend
Next.js API Routes - server-side logic
NextAuth.js - authentication and authorization
Prisma ORM - database interaction
PostgreSQL – relational database
bcrypt - password hashing

Key features
1. Authentication system
- Registration via email with verification
- OAuth integration (Google, GitHub)
- Multi-factor authentication
- Management of multiple accounts
- Secure password storage with bcrypt
2. Profile management
- Editing personal information
- Uploading avatars
- Unique nicknames with auto-generation
- Email address verification
- Linking/unlinking social accounts
3. Subscription and billing system
- Multi-tier subscription plans (Personal, Pro, Team)
- Flexible limits system via JSON configuration
- Payment and transaction history
- Resource usage monitoring
- Ready for Stripe integration
4. Internationalization
- Support for multiple languages (EN, RU, UA)
- Interface localization and error message translation
- Adaptive user language detection
5. UI/UX design
- Modern design with dark theme
- Fully responsive interface
- Animations and transitions
- Loading states and feedback
- Accessibility (a11y) of components
Work details
Added 1 August 2025
98 views
Freelancer
Dmitro Yuzik
Ukraine Odessa
No reviews

Available for hire Available for hire
On the service 10 months 11 days